barcode-talker実行エラーについての質問


231] 2011/02/27 15:58:28


こんにちは。お世話になります。
京都市在住の畠(ハタケ)です。
この度、MLに参加させていただき、初めての投稿になりますが、どうぞ宜しくお願いします。

さて、早速の質問で恐縮なのですが、

barcode talkerをインストールして、IDとパスワードの登録も終え、合い言葉も取得することができ、正常に働いているようで、喜んでいます。

ところが、他のパソコン、家内の所有するパソコンにも同様にインストールして、バーコードトーカーを実行させると、「ジャーン」という音と共に、以下のようなエラーメッセージが表示されてそれっきり止まってしまいます。
アンインストールして再度インストールし、試みたのですが、結果は同じです。

---- ---- ----------------
BarcodeTalker.exe - 致命的なエラーの重要メッセージ
CLR エラー: 80004005.
プログラムを終了します。 エンターは OK

---- ----- ---

インストールしたパソコンは、何れもXPノートパソコンです。

試しに、他のXP デスクトップ・パソコンにも同様にインストールして、起動させてみましたら、これは正常に作動しています。

何か良き対処法がありましたら宜しくお願いします。




234] 2011/02/27 16:49:19


畠さん:

Barcode-Talkerプロジェクト 世話人の西です。

引用〜
BarcodeTalker.exe - 致命的なエラーの重要メッセージ
CLR エラー: 80004005.
プログラムを終了します。 エンターは OK
ここまで。
以上のエラーメッセージについて調べましたのでご報告します。

.NET Framework 2.0(どっとねっとふれーむわーく にーてんぜろ)、
がインストールされていない可能性があります。
Barcode-Talkerの動作に必要なバージョンは3.0になります。

お手数ですが、以下のURLから.NET Framework 3.5 SP1をダウンロードして、インストールしてください。
以下のパッケージで2.0、3.0、3.5のファイルが揃います。
displaylang=ja">http://www.microsoft.com/downloads/details.aspx?familyid=AB99342F-5D1A-413D-8319-81DA479AB0D7&">displaylang=ja

これで、動作するようになるのではないでしょうか。


Barcode-Talkerのインストーラには、.NET Framework 3.5のファイルをインストールする機能があります。
ところが、それより前の2.0がインストールされていない環境では、必要なファイルが不足するのかもしれません。


--




238] 2011/02/27 19:09:01


西さん、再度お世話になります。
京都の畠です。

早速のアドバイスありがとう御座いました。
教えていただいたとおり、「

displaylang=ja">http://www.microsoft.com/downloads/details.aspx?familyid=AB99342F-5D1A-413D-8319-81DA479AB0D7&">displaylang=ja

より、「dotnetfx35setup.exe」をDLして、
インストールしたのですが、結果は同じでした。
2〜3度試みたのですが、残念ながら先と同じエラーメッセージが表示されます。
暫く更新が滞っているからなのかもしれませんね。

お手数をおかけしますが、再度ご教授いただければ幸いです。

なお、他のパソコンでは正常に動作していますので、
急ぐものではありませんのでお手すきの時でも宜しくお願いします。




245] 2011/02/27 22:45:55


畠さん:

Barcode-Talkerプロジェクト 世話人の西です

引用〜
2〜3度試みたのですが、残念ながら先と同じエラーメッセージが表示されます。
ここまで。
外してしまいましたね、すみません。

他に考えられるものを、ありそうな順番に並べておきます。
1) .NET Framework 1.1すらインストールされていない。Windowsが更新されていない。
2) .NET Framework 2.0の構成ファイルが壊れている。
3) Barcode-Talkerが互換モードで実行されている。
4) その他、不明な原因がある。

以下はそれぞれ思いつく解決法です。
1)については、Windows UpdateからWindowsの更新を行うことで解決できます。サービスパックはインストールされていますか?
2)については、コントロールパネルから.NET Frameworkと名の付くプログラムを削除してから、先日のdotnetfx35setup.exeを実行することで解決できます。
3)については、実行ファイルのプロパティから設定することで解決できます。
4)については、超能力で解決できそうです。冗談です。Windowsの再インストールなどでしょうか。




    BT-ml 過去ログ に戻る